Description:
Obverse
Deventer Coat of Arms surrounded with Deventer's alternate Weapons and Portugese-style overcoat, crowned in a pearl circle with double ring ‘ME VIGILANTE FLORET DAVENTRIA’;
lily and within the circle ‘VALORIS PORTUGALLICI’ (with the value of a portugalozer)
Reverse
Cross inside the pearl circle with outside ‘IN CHRISTO CRUCIFIXO SALUS NOSTRA’.
